Allison hesitated slightly and opened the envelope.
There were no bloody images, not even a hint of visual impact, only lines of Galaxy Universal Language.
But the contents made Allison hold his breath and focus.
...
[Hello, fellow in New Federation Minter City.
Thank you for taking the time out of your busy schedule to come to my territory and, using your ubiquitous intelligence abilities, carried out an attack on me.
My host pleaded with you, yet you still chose to end her life, which made me very angry.
But you have been a benefactor to me, as I was defeated by her consciousness when I fought for her body... my love for my home planet lost to her desire for survival. My confusion and weakness at that time led me to pay a heavy price.
You killed her, yet liberated me.
Isn’t this an interesting phenomenon? You might be puzzled as to why this happened, but I can tell you the reason.
This is a resurrection opportunity given by the Pioneer.
Only this time, it is considered a form of protection given to the five of us by the Faya Civilization and a remedy for my particular situation.
Oh right, you probably don’t understand what the Faya Civilization is.
It is a high-dimensional human civilization, and the Milky Way is just a corner of their territory. They have created this civilization trial, constantly supplementing the main civilization of the Milky Way, nurturing new high-dimensional civilizations to replenish themselves.
Perhaps you are wondering how I came to know this.
I don’t just know this, I also know that in this trial, five civilizations are participating, and two of them will merge into the Milky Way, while two will be eliminated.
This elimination is not the planetary destruction you might think.
In fact, the planetary destruction you experienced was merely to leave the humans on your home planet with a sense of awe. When the second trial occurs, the humans on the planet will recall the outcome of another temporal dimension and, hence, regard the "Abyss" with reverence.
Habitable planets and civilization greenhouses are the property of the Faya Civilization, and the greatest value of low-dimensional humans is only as a gene pool. True destruction is biological extinction followed by reseeding.
Heavens, I actually told you so much.
Your biggest question now might be, who I am, and why I know these things.
Listen up, you bastard.
When the five civilizations compete, the civilizations that finish in the top three will enter the third trial, and my civilization has waited several hundred Galaxy Years for this, we will be the first in this trial.
We have a plentiful population, rich experience, and the determination to sacrifice over eighty percent of our population.
We will sweep through everything in the "Abyss."
And you, I will drag you out and in the powerful yet hypocritical New Federation governance, drag you out and put you before me to let you experience the thrill of getting your head blown off.
And your home planet will be the enemy of Semi Star!
Do take care of yourself.
Cheater.]
...
Ping!
Allison shattered the glass cup, staring coldly at the internet terminal with his eyes full of resolve.
He deleted the email, ordered his trusted subordinates to erase all traces, and then sat there, lost in thought.
What carelessness.
Unexpectedly, there was such a protective mechanism.
The civilization trial had not yet begun and he had already established a powerful enemy for his home planet, this...
Allison sat there with a gloomy face, lost in thought.

In the capital of the Fifth Administrative Star of Wind, on the newly built ground suspension road.
A luxurious suspension car was gliding slowly, and the driver, 026, was looking around, searching for road signs and indicator boards.
Yang Ming was sitting in the back seat with his legs crossed, having changed into a formal suit, he sipped a drink and appreciated the city scenery outside the window.
Although the Fifth Administrative Star was relatively poor, due to its large population, the overall environment was quite decent.
At least, it looked much more prosperous than those pirate black-market planets.
Lyu’s miniature projection appeared beside him and whispered, "Boss, the email has been read."
"Oh?"
Yang Ming raised an eyebrow nonchalantly, "Did they believe it?"
"There’s no way to deduce that."
Lyu smiled and said, "However, I did gain a little unexpected harvest."
"What harvest?"
"I hid a tiny trick in that email, a toolbox I begged from my teacher back at Intelligent Mechanic Dusk, modified to target the New Federation’s network characteristics, I managed to get some virus into them."
Lyu deliberately kept it a secret, as Yang Ming seemed about to scold her, she quickly unfolded a projection screen.
"Boss look! The email we designed was sent to this inbox! This inbox uses an alias, but the registration address is interesting, it’s in the New Federation’s House of Representatives."
Yang Ming furrowed his brows slightly, "You mean, my competitor has already infiltrated the New Federation’s House of Representatives?"
"Yes, but it’s also possible that he’s just doing chores or working as a security guard in the House."
"I lean towards him being a politician."
Yang Ming slightly pouted and said slowly,
"Being a politician is a pretty decent development path, spending ten or twenty years running it, using the information gained in the game, should be able to mix into a good position.
"This guy has a clear mind, he’s already thought about how to let his home planet survive in the Milky Way once they pass the trial.
"Although the New Federation is hypocritical, many of their citizens already see democracy and human rights as the most sacred terms, if they successfully enter the New Federation, his home planet might also suffer exploitation from major capital, but the safety of the lives of their people is probably guaranteed."
Lyu nodded continuously, analyzing carefully, "Boss, should we continue to probe them?"
"One probe is enough, wait for him to go to the Guel Alliance for investigation."
Yang Ming smiled and said,
"Sometimes, doing more means making more mistakes.
"We already have the advantage, wait for him to become active and naturally reveal flaws.
"Now, let me take a few days off, I want to give myself a holiday, indulge well on this barren planet, and contribute my share to stimulating the economy."
Lyu: ...
"Boss, do you need me to mark the night spots for you?"
"Is there a place with many beauties?"
"There is!"
"Bring more of them!"
Lyu rolled her eyes, a string of marked points appeared on the suspension car’s navigation, smart 026 already discerned which are exotic places without the boss having to say a word, and immediately drove towards them.
A dozen minutes later.
Yang Ming stood with his hands behind his back in front of the huge "Good Times" signboard, nodding with satisfaction.
"Boss! I’m going to park!"
"Aren’t you going home? Go ahead," Yang Ming waved his hand, "enjoy your vacation, just remember to come back to pick me up."
"Uh," 026 leaned in to ask, "don’t you need me to accompany you?"
Going to such spots, bringing a female partner isn’t that a waste of resources?
Yang Ming calmly stretched his neck, showing a slight smile.
When Yang Ming vanished into the sight of 026 with a relaxed stride, Lyu’s projection appeared in the central control of the suspension car.
murmured softly, "I really didn’t expect the boss to go to such places."
Lyu suddenly recalled the indulgent years Yang Ming had with Edwan.
"He’s a regular."
giggled, but then his expression turned more somber, leaning on the steering wheel, staring blankly ahead.
Lyu asked softly, "Are you really going home?"
"Yeah, I still have to go home and see," 026 murmured, "I want to see what they’ve spent the money I sent back on, I’ve already given them so much."
"I’m not human, and I can’t understand this emotion, but based on my database analysis and modeling analysis of such situations, I don’t suggest you appear before them."
Lyu reminded:
"Just take a distant glance, you’ve already done enough for them."
"Okay, but..."
thought for a moment, and then said:
"I’ll still go have a look, and make it clear to them, so that I won’t have to think about it too much in the future."
"Suit yourself."
Lyu shrugged, then smiled and said:
"This is Wind, not Sherman or the New Federation, no need to fear any incidents."
chuckled, driving the suspension car away slowly.
